A perfect wooded hideaway for someone who enjoys the stillness of nature & the chance to see foxes, deer, woodchuck, turkeys & more, while enjoying easy access to all the fun Ames has to offer! The Fox Den is a cozy efficiency apartment in a duplex nestled at the end of a cul-de-sac, just a short walk to downtown Ames (the library, post office, grocery store, main street shopping, farmers market, city parks, bus line & more), a brief drive to campus, many tasty restaurants, and easy access to highway 35.
The space: Although this efficiency apartment is in a basement, the large windows keep the apartment feeling open and spacious. There is a stovetop, microwave and toaster for cooking your own meals, as well as a 3/4 fridge. You'll also have access to wireless internet, a patio, fire pit and hot tub. At night, the path to and from the apartment is well lit for safe access. We specifically constructed the space with noise canceling features, but you may still hear guests above if there is someone staying in the upper portion of the duplex.
This property is a duplex with two units. This listing is in the basement, and includes a bed/living area, a kitchenette, a private bathroom, a shared laundry room, and shared outdoor 4-person hot tub with jets. The second unit (Downtown Ames Peaceful Getaway) is a 2 bedroom 1 bath unit on the main level. Neither unit has access to the other's space. The only shared area is the laundry room.
